A critical sensor supplier for XPeng’s autonomous driving system declares force majeure due to a sudden geopolitical crisis, halting all shipments. The production line is heavily reliant on this specific sensor. Which course of action best reflects XPeng’s values of adaptability, proactive problem-solving, and maintaining production efficiency while minimizing customer impact?
Correct
XPeng, as a rapidly evolving smart electric vehicle company, values adaptability and strategic pivoting. Consider a situation where a key component supplier faces unexpected production halts due to unforeseen circumstances like geopolitical instability or natural disasters. The initial strategic plan heavily relied on this supplier. The best course of action involves a multifaceted approach. First, immediately activate pre-vetted alternative suppliers, even if it means a temporary increase in component costs or a slight delay in production. This demonstrates proactive risk management and supply chain resilience. Second, reassess the current production schedule and prioritize models with components from unaffected suppliers to minimize overall disruption. Third, communicate transparently with stakeholders – both internal teams and external customers – about the situation, revised timelines, and mitigation strategies. This builds trust and manages expectations. Fourth, the team must analyze the long-term implications of the supplier disruption and explore opportunities for diversifying the supply chain further, including potentially investing in in-house component production or forging partnerships with geographically diverse suppliers. Finally, encourage cross-functional collaboration between engineering, procurement, and manufacturing teams to identify alternative component designs or manufacturing processes that can reduce reliance on the affected supplier. This collaborative problem-solving fosters innovation and strengthens the company’s ability to adapt to future disruptions. The ability to quickly shift strategies, maintain open communication, and foster collaborative problem-solving is paramount for XPeng’s continued success in a dynamic market.

XPeng Motors faces a critical situation: a widespread software glitch is causing unexpected acceleration in a subset of its P7 model vehicles. News of several minor accidents surfaces on social media, creating a PR nightmare. Considering XPeng’s operational context, which course of action represents the MOST comprehensive and strategically sound approach to manage this crisis effectively, ensuring minimal long-term damage to the company’s reputation and adherence to regulatory compliance?
Correct
The core of XPeng’s operational success relies on a robust and adaptable crisis management framework, particularly given the complexities of autonomous vehicle technology and stringent regulatory oversight. Effective crisis management isn’t just about reacting to immediate problems; it’s about proactive planning, clear communication, and the ability to maintain stakeholder confidence.
The most critical aspect is the immediate and transparent communication with regulatory bodies (like the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ology in China or relevant authorities in other operating regions), XPeng customers, and the general public. This proactive communication helps to control the narrative, address concerns promptly, and demonstrate a commitment to safety and transparency. A delayed or inadequate response can lead to severe reputational damage, regulatory penalties, and loss of customer trust.
Secondly, business continuity planning is vital. This involves identifying potential disruptions (e.g., supply chain interruptions, data breaches, or vehicle recalls) and developing strategies to minimize their impact. This includes having backup systems, alternative suppliers, and well-defined procedures for handling different types of crises.
Thirdly, swift and decisive action is crucial. This involves mobilizing the necessary resources, implementing contingency plans, and making timely decisions to mitigate the crisis. This may involve halting production, issuing safety alerts, or initiating a product recall. The actions taken must be proportionate to the severity of the crisis and guided by ethical considerations and legal requirements.
Finally, post-crisis review and learning are essential. This involves analyzing the causes of the crisis, evaluating the effectiveness of the response, and identifying areas for improvement. This learning process should inform future crisis management planning and help to prevent similar incidents from occurring. Ignoring this step risks repeating the same mistakes in future crises.
